Webster's 1913 Dictionary

RESTFUL

RESTFUL Rest "ful (rst "fl ), a.

 

1. Being at rest; quiet. Shak.

 

2. Giving rest; freeing from toil, trouble, etc. Tired with all these, for restful death I cry. Shak. -- Rest "ful *ly, adv. -- Rest "ful *ness, n.

American Oxford Thesaurus

restful

restful adjective a restful cruise: relaxed, relaxing, quiet, calm, calming, tranquil, soothing, peaceful, placid, reposeful, leisurely, undisturbed, untroubled; sleepy. ANTONYMS exciting.
